Ron Jaworski's RiverWinds Golf & Tennis Club
About
Ron Jaworski’s Riverwinds Golf & Tennis Club is situated along a scenic stretch of grassland between the banks of the Woodbury Creek and the deep harbor marina on the Delaware River. Its location gives it the feel of traditional seaside links courses found in Scotland and Ireland, which is further enforced by the sod-wall bunkers that lurk near the greens. The layout features plenty of water and incorporates the surrounding wetlands as well. One unique feature of the golf course is that the routing winds across a mile-long twisting burn, creating a visually interesting setting. Riverwinds begins with a gentle, mostly flat front nine but the mounding becomes more aggressive as you move onto the back. All of the holes face a different direction, which means you’ll most likely be using all the clubs in your bag to tackle the crosswinds and rugged terrain.

Some good, some not so good.
Played July 4th, staff was friendly, we started on time and had no problems with pace of play, might have waited on two or three holes for a couple minutes, nothing to really complain about. Course layout rewards accuracy rams some risk taking but fescues and rough are penal. Greens were firm and fast and generally is very good shape with one outlier that looked as if 25% of the green was being repaired. Bunkers could use some attention but were playable. Overall you are paying for the views of the Philadelphia skyline, for $124 there are better options out there in terms of value, but a little known fact is they offer a $25 replay rate which is a great deal if you feel the need to play another nine like we did.
